Canadian Publications on the Soviet Union and Eastern Europe for 1976

This is the first annual bibliography of works pertaining to the Soviet Union and eastern Europe, as well as to the peoples of those countries settled in Canada, published by Canadian scholars. The primary purpose of the bibliography is to provide an up-to-date research tool for persons working in the area. It is also hoped that it will make known the range of activities and areas of expertise of Canadian scholars.

The bibliography notes more than 300 monographs, articles, review articles, identifiable sections of books, signed encyclopaedia entries and published occasional papers. Six doctoral dissertations accepted by Canadian universities are included and are intended as a supplement to the bibliography for 1950-75 published by G. R. Barratt in the Canadian Slavonic Papers, vol. XVIII, no. 2 (June 1976), pp. 187-98. Reviews, newspaper articles, mimeographed papers and belles-lettres have been excluded.

For the purpose of this bibliography "Soviet and Eastern European" refers to all Slavic areas plus the remaining territory of the Soviet Union, Finland, the Baltic states, Hungary, Romania, Albania and East Germany (after 1945), but not to Turkey, Austria, Greece, China or international communism outside the bloc. Scholarly material pertaining to settlers from the included countries in Canada is also listed.

The bibliography is for 1976 and includes 1976 imprints and journals dated 1976. Items dated prior to 1976, but which actually appeared in 1976, have also been included. (Journal dates are 1976 unless otherwise indicated.)

This bibliography is a product primarily of submissions by members of the Canadian Association of Slavists. Additional entries were provided by the compiler after a survey of some 200 leading journals in the field. In this regard, the compiler wishes to thank Alexander Malycky for his advice and assistance. In a few instances, recent issues could not be consulted either because they were being bound or were late in publication. Readers are requested to bring any omissions to the attention of the compiler and especially to submit lists of their 1977 publications to the journal's offices.
